What is BS 7979 - Limestone fines for use with Portland cement about?  

BS 7979 is the British standard on cement and lime used in building construction that improves both the environmental footprint and potentially the basic performance of concrete.  

BS 7979 specifies requirements for the production, chemical composition and mechanical and physical properties of limestone fines for use in combination with CEM I Portland cement strength class 42.5 or higher conforming to BS EN 197-1 as a component of concrete, mortar or grout.  

BS 7979 also specifies requirements for marking, provision of information, sampling and testing for acceptance at delivery, and conformity criteria for the manufacturer’s auto-control system.

Why should you use BS 7979 - Limestone fines for use with Portland cement 

Limestone fines is a fine powder obtained from the processing of limestone with an appropriate particle size distribution that can improve the physical properties (such as workability) and reduce bleeding of the concrete. 

BS 7979 provides the preparation of limestone fines giving the measure of chemical composition and moisture content. 

BS 7979 determines the compressive strength and physical properties of limestone fines with CEM I Portland cement. 

BS 7979 specifies marking of limestone fines on the bag or the delivery note as well as sampling and testing for acceptance inspection at delivery. 

Overall, BS 7979 guides you through the usage of limestone fines in combination with Portland cement to improve concrete sustainability with no negative impacts on your structure’s constructability, performance and durability.
